Monday, I took a day trip to the historical city of Aachen with Heather, Jacky, Elina, Trine and Liam. Aachen is on the very western border of Germany, right next to Belgium and the Netherlands, and it was the center of the Carolingian Empire way back when, not to mention the coronation and tombsite of the great emporer Charlemagne.
The Dom, definitely the highlight of the day, was UNbelievable, full of mosaic and Byzantine art and motifs....the art historian in me went a little nutso.
